8+ Accurate Track & Field Wind Calculator Online

track and field wind calculator

8+ Accurate Track & Field Wind Calculator Online

This tool is designed to determine the influence of wind on sprinting and jumping performances in athletics. It specifically quantifies the wind assistance or hindrance experienced by an athlete during a race or jump, measured in meters per second (m/s). This measurement is taken by an anemometer placed near the track or runway and is crucial for validating records and ensuring fair competition. For instance, a reading exceeding +2.0 m/s during a 100-meter sprint would disqualify the performance from being considered a record, even if the athlete achieved a remarkable time.

The significance of assessing wind conditions stems from the substantial impact that even a slight breeze can have on athletic results. A tailwind can significantly reduce the time taken to complete a sprint, while a headwind can increase it. Historically, these measurements have been critical in maintaining the integrity of official results and world records, ensuring that achievements are primarily attributable to the athlete’s skill and effort rather than external environmental factors. This standardization allows for meaningful comparisons of performances across different competitions and eras.

Score! Track Meet Scoring Calculator Online + Tips

track meet scoring calculator

Score! Track Meet Scoring Calculator Online + Tips

This tool automates the process of tabulating results from athletics competitions, determining team and individual scores based on pre-defined scoring systems. For example, in a dual meet, the scoring might award 5 points for first place, 3 points for second, and 1 point for third in each event, with a system totaling these points to identify the winning team.

The use of such a utility provides increased accuracy and efficiency in results management, mitigating human error inherent in manual calculations. Its adoption facilitates timely dissemination of results, enhancing the experience for athletes, coaches, and spectators. Historically, calculation of track meet scores was a labor-intensive task, prone to delays and potential inaccuracies, a problem this automates.

Track Lighting Load Calc: Residential Guide + Tips

how is track lighting load in residences calculated

Track Lighting Load Calc: Residential Guide + Tips

Determining the electrical demand of track lighting systems within a home involves calculating the total wattage of all fixtures intended for installation on the track. This calculation necessitates summing the individual wattage ratings of each light fixture. For example, if a track features five 75-watt bulbs, the total load becomes 375 watts (5 x 75 = 375).

Accurate load calculation is crucial for electrical safety and code compliance. Overloading circuits can lead to tripped breakers, damaged wiring, or even fire hazards. Historically, lighting loads were often underestimated, leading to these dangers. Modern electrical codes emphasize precise load assessment to ensure a safe and functional electrical system. Furthermore, correctly assessing the demand allows homeowners to choose appropriate circuit breakers and wiring gauges, optimizing performance and preventing unnecessary energy consumption.
